Sutton quits Imps

29 September 2010 11:30
Chris Sutton has quit as Lincoln manager after just a year in charge. The former Blackburn and Chelsea striker and his assistant, ex-West Ham defender Ian Pearce, have left the npower League Two club for personal reasons. The Imps sit in 20th place in the table after a disappointing start to the season, having picked up only two wins from nine games. They drew 0-0 with Burton Albion last night. The board of directors have arranged a press conference for this evening.
